Re: Delay 1 behaviour

Hi Tom,
Thanks for the prompt reply. After receiving your reply, I ran some tests. It seems that the function Delay 1 only duplicates the behaviour of a first order delay and Delay 1I if Input = 0 at Starttime. My safest option is then to always use Delay1I, and not Delay1.

Re: Problem with reading Data variable

Hi Tony, Thanks for the prompt reply - you obviously know how frustrating it can be to find an error in a model :D I've learned something new - it is the variable in the spreadsheet / CSV / tab delimited file that must have the same name as the variable in the Vensim model, not the filename that mus...
